What does Town of Hawthorne spend the most on?
Based on 603 tracked contracts, Town of Hawthorne spends most on Capital Projects (359), Environmental Services (71), Grants (70), Recreation & Community Services (62), and Public Works (41). Contract types include Loan, Excavating, CONSTRUCTION, Product, and UTILITIES. Who are Town of Hawthorne's current vendors?
Town of Hawthorne currently works with vendors including NBC, TYLERS EXCAVATING, NORTHERN INTERSTATE, WREN WORKS, BROOKS BENES, LAKE EFFECT, DAN HASKINS, SIPPES, MILESTONE MATERIAL, VIASTAT, and DC HIGHWAY DEPT. These vendors span contract types like Loan, Excavating, CONSTRUCTION, Product, and UTILITIES.
